About this course

To introduce Yoga's gentle, low impact movements ideal for those with osteopenia (the stage before osteoporosis) and osteoporosis. The course is also suitable for those with osteoarthritis and rheumatoid arthritis often experienced alongside osteoporosis. Yoga will help to lubricate joints and keep them moving smoothly; improve strength, flexibility, balance, co-ordination, endurance, muscle mass, agility and energy level - all important for adults with osteoporosis. Your 'approach' to yoga and 'how' you practise will also help you to develop an increased level of awareness, which in turn will lead to practising with an increased attentiveness to your body - getting to know yourself by listening to your body's feedback and responding appropriately. The course is suitable for all ages, for beginners and those who already practise yoga. Each week there is a simple, step by step guided practice where we work on a variety of postures which are adapted and modified. The practices and techniques include slow, gentle, straightforward movements; breathing techniques and relaxation. What Yoga can do for you: - Improve posture - Create better balance - Increase range of movement - Make you stronger - Refine your co-ordination - Lower blood pressure - Alleviate stress & anxiety What will you achieve by the end of the course? - To understand postures to increase strength, correct alignment and improve balance - To understand how to modify & adapt postures to suit individual needs - To build stamina and improve focus - To practice moving with a neutral spine - To practice moving slowly and mindfully
